MEN'S NIGHT

February 6, 2026


Our theme this year is Messy Grace: Bridging the Tension of Truth and Grace.  Bridging that tension can be difficult, especially when culture meets scripture. When boldly and courageously proclaimed, the powerful combination of grace and truth, helps to transform lives for Jesus Christ. 

 

Caleb Kaltenbach will be our speaker this year. He is one of the pastors at Shepherd Church in Los Angeles, the same church Dudley Rutherford was with a few years ago. Caleb is also an author who has written several books, including Messy Grace. He regularly speaks on faith, biblical sexuality and gender, and ministry systems. A graduate of Ozark Christian College and Talbot School of Theology, Caleb received his doctorate from Dallas Theological Seminary. He and his wife, Amy, have two teenagers and reside in Southern California.

 

If you’ve not heard of Caleb, he has a powerful testimony of growing up in a household with LGBTQ+ parents.  He has firsthand experienced how Christians witnessed to him and his family, and also experienced other Christians shaming his family.
